I will be hunting solo on opening morning in a stand near a watering hole at a pinch point in an oak flat. I'll have the camera in there a couple weeks before hand to figure out where the does are walking. I might take the recurve depending on where they are coming through. If any bucks show on the camera that are worth shooting, the curve will stay at home so I can make it happen if need be. It will need to be 140" or better to get an arrow from me opening day and through October...
I'll be filming my wife in the evening in a stand on another oak flat nearby or over the food plot in the bottom. I would love for us to both draw blood on our first hunts of the year...
